I started working out with Booty Camp four weeks ago, after quitting the gym (again!) because I rarely went and lack of progress. I joined Booty Camp for two reasons:

  1. In the past, I have had incredible results working with a trainer.
  2. I enjoy and feel more motivated in group exercise than working out on my own.

After eight, 1-hour outdoor workouts over four weeks (plus DVD workouts), I am happy to report some progress! :)

  • Start Total Measurements: 207.25 inches
  • Week 4 Total Measurements: 201.25 inches (down 6 inches)
  • Start Body Fat: 27.8%
  • Week 4 Body Fat: 25.3% (down 2.5%)

It’s so exciting to see results fast!  When I exercised alone, I found many excuses to delay my workouts (“I’ll do it tomorrow!”). Now, it has really helped to have a schedule that I have to stick to.  While these numbers are great, I know I can do even better.  Right now I eat better but still don’t eat as well as I should.  I really gotta try to keep my eating habits in check.

Geek Chic: A Look for Ladies Who Wear Glasses.

Here is a really simple look that I wanted to do because I recently got a brand new pair of frames.  I find that I can get away with wearing more eye makeup when I’m wearing glasses.  I have smallish eyes to begin with and I think my eyes get lost behind my glasses if I’m not wearing any eye makeup.  In this look I emphasize the top lash and leave the bottom quite bare to brighten the eyes.

Swatches (from left): MAC Carbon, MAC Smoke ‘n Diamonds (LE), MAC Coquette, GOSH Bananas

Get the Look

For the eyes, thickly line the top lash line with a creamy black pencil eyeliner (Annabelle Ohmygoth!) and smudge up slightly.  Go over the eyeliner with a matte black (MAC Carbon).  Place a shimmery gray taupe (MAC Smoke ‘n Diamonds) all over the lid  and blend into the black.  Smudge more black into the lower lash line and blend into the grey. Place a medium matte taupe (MAC Coquette) into the crease, and the outer half of the lower lash line. Add light by lining the inner half of the lower lash line with a light gold (GOSH Bananas). Add lots of black mascara (Marcelle Power Volume Mascara) to the top lashes only.

For the cheeks, keep it simple with a pinky brown blush on the apples (NARS Douceur).

For the lips, finish off with a quick swipe of a neutral pink lipstick (Chanel Mademoiselle).
